Planning a 4/6 drop and wondering about wheels and tires

Planning a drop on my 86 and have the opprotunity to purchase a foose wheel and toyo combo. The foose wheels are legends and the toyos are 235/65R-17. Do you think this will look good and most importantly, will this work.

Re: Planning a 4/6 drop and wondering about wheels and tires

The wheel/tire combo will be too tall for the drop, it will bottom out on the front tires. That combo is 29.03" tall.
